Craftsmanship and Tradition

Tanjore paintings, originating from the town of Thanjavur in Tamil Nadu, are renowned for their unique style and enduring appeal. This painting is made using the traditional gesso work technique, where the canvas is layered with a paste made from chalk powder, tamarind seed powder, and Arabic gum. This creates a raised surface that is then adorned with vibrant colors and shimmering gold foil. The meticulous application of gold leaf, a hallmark of Tanjore art, adds a regal and captivating dimension. Precious and semi-precious stones are often embedded to enhance the visual splendor, making each piece a treasure to behold. The artists employ a distinctive color palette, dominated by rich reds, greens, blues, and yellows, each shade carefully chosen to enhance the overall aesthetic. The skilled artisans who create these paintings infuse each piece with devotion and dedication, ensuring that the tradition of Tanjore art continues to thrive.

Gajalakshmi: A Tale of Abundance

This painting depicts the form known as Gajalakshmi, a particularly auspicious representation. According to Hindu mythology, she emerged during the churning of the cosmic ocean (Samudra Manthan). As the gods and demons churned the ocean to obtain the elixir of immortality (Amrita), many divine beings and treasures arose, including Lakshmi, the goddess of wealth and prosperity. In this particular depiction, she is often seen seated on a lotus flower, flanked by two elephants (Gaja) who are shown anointing her with water. This imagery represents the divine abundance and prosperity that she bestows upon her devotees. The lotus she sits upon symbolizes purity, enlightenment, and spiritual awakening, while the elephants symbolize strength, royalty, and cosmic power. The imagery evokes a sense of harmony, balance, and the constant flow of abundance that is available to those who seek it. The presence of Gajalakshmi is believed to bring good fortune, success, and overall well-being to the home or space where her image is displayed.
